Berry, van den Ham go 1-2 in the pole vault, Lion women in third at SLC Outdoor Championships

NACOGDOCHES – East Texas A&M University women's track and field student-athletes Peyton Berry and Kira van den Ham went 1-2 in the women's pole vault to start off the Southland Conference Outdoor Championships on Thursday at Homer Bryce Stadium.

WOMEN
Both Berry (Argyle) and van den Ham (Bunnik, The Netherlands) cleared 12-8.25 (3.87m) in the women's pole vault as did UIW's Alaine Hernandez as the trio tied for the best mark. Berry cleared it in her first attempt, to be declared the winner, while van den Ham cleared the previous height, 3.77m in her first attempt to break the tie over Hernandez.
 
The Lion duo also went 1-2 at the indoor conference championships in the pole vault. Berry, a freshman, is the first Lion to sweep the pole vault titles in the same season since former All-American Minna Svaerd in 2021-22.
 
Two Lions also scored in the long jump, as Rivka Goede (Curacao) just missed the podium, placing fourth with a mark of 19-4.25 (5.90m). Tina Samson (Benin, Nigeria) jumped 18-10 (5.74m) for sixth.
 
In the preliminary races on the track, Anete Randma (Tallinn, Estonia) punched her ticket to the finals in the 1,500 meter run with a time of 4:33.62, while Kaat de Staercke (Zemst, Belgium) took 13th with a time of 4:41.40, missing the finals by 0.35 seconds.
 
Samarah Green (Abilene – Cooper) took ninth in the 400 meter hurdles with a time of 1:01.81, missing the finals by 0.04 seconds. Niamh Le'Gall (Wallasey, England) clocked in at 23.79 seconds in the 200 meter dash to finish fifth and is through to the finals.
 
MEN
In the lone event that the Lion men scored on Thursday, Jonas Gran (Riehen, Switzerland) threw 192-2 (58.57m) for sixth in the javelin and Joshua Kommer (Balingen, Germany) had a mark of 185-9 (56.61m) for eighth.
 
On the track, Cheyne West (Rochester, England) is through to the finals with a time of 51.91 seconds for fourth in the 400 meter hurdles. East Texas A&M had the two fastest times in the 200 meter dash as Oguz Uyar (Cannakale, Turkey) timed 20.65 seconds for first and Enoch Fosuhene (Accra, Ghana) took second with a time of 20.67 seconds.
 
In the final race of the day, Jeremiah Garcia (Lubbock – Eaton) recorded a time of 31:45.09 for ninth in the 10,000 meter run, missing the top eight by .13 seconds.  
 
COMBINED EVENTS
Three Lions began the men's decathlon on Thursday. Gran is in fourth after the first five events with 3,690 points. He ended the day by recording a time of 49.36 seconds in the 400 meter dash, which was the second fastest in the 12-person field.
 
Joshua Nate (Geneva School of Boerne) is in seventh place with 3,339 points, taking third in the 400 meter dash with a time of 50.09 seconds. Kommer is in ninth place with 3,288 points, his best placement was in the shot put, recording a mark of 39-8 (12.09m) for sixth.
 
In the women's heptathlon, Samson totaled 2,893 points for 10th, while Evelyn Cortes (Bogota, Columbia) is in 12th place with a total of 2,777 points in the 19-person field after four events.
 
Samson threw 40-3.5 (12.28m) in the shot put, which was the second-best mark, while Cortes' mark of 37-10 (11.53m) was fifth.
 
WOMEN'S TEAM SCORES
The Lions scored 26 points as a team on Thursday, sitting in third place. SFA leads the way with 34.50 points.

MEN'S TEAM SCORES
Gran and Kommer scored four points for the Lions in the javelin, which puts them in eighth after three events. A&M-Corpus Christi is in the lead with 35 points.
